noun
- 温室效应
the problem of the gradual rise in temperature of the earth's atmosphere, caused by an increase of gases such as carbon dioxide in the air surrounding the earth, which trap the heat of the sun
柯林斯词典
- 温室效应
The greenhouse effectis the problem caused by increased quantities of gases such as carbon dioxide in the air. These gases trap the heat from the sun, and cause a gradual rise in the temperature of the Earth's atmosphere.
